Downsampling graphs using spectral theory

2011 IEEE International Conference on Acoustics, Speech and Signal Processing (ICASSP), 2011
In this paper we present methods for downsampling datasets defined on graphs (i.e., graph-signals) by extending downsampling results for traditional N-dimensional signals. In particular, we study the spectral properties of k-regular bipartite graphs (K-RBG) and prove that downsampling in these graphs is governed by a Nyquist-like criteria.

Domination and Spectral Graph Theory

2020
Spectral graph theory studies graphs through the eigenvalues and eigenvectors of matrices associated with them. In this chapter we show how domination parameters have appeared in spectral graph theory, including the domination number γ, the total domination number γt, and the signed domination number γs.

Characterising insomnia: A graph spectral theory approach

2015 37th Annual International Conference of the IEEE Engineering in Medicine and Biology Society (EMBC), 2015
This paper introduces a computational approach to characterise healthy controls and insomniacs based on graph spectral theory. Based upon expert-generated hypnograms of sleep onset periods, a network of sleep stages transitions is derived to compute four similarity distances amongst subjects' sleeping patterns.
